Fawn plants 2/3 of the garden with vegetables. Her son plants the remainder of the garden. He decides to use 1/2 of his plant fl

owers, and in the rest, he plants herbs. What fraction of the entire garden is planted in flowers?

Given that Fawn plants vegetables into garden = \frac{2}{3}

Exact amount of garden is not given so we can assume that amount of garden is 1.

Then remaining amount of garden =1-\frac{2}{3}=\frac{3}{3}-\frac{2}{3}=\frac{3-2}{3}=\frac{1}{3}

Now half of the remaining part of garden that is half of \frac{1}{3} rd part of garden is planted with flowers

so that will be \frac{1}{2}*\frac{1}{3}=\frac{1}{6}

Hence required fraction for the answer will be 1/6.
